Analysis
The most recent figure for total reserves (gold at market value) (sdr), per capita in Seychelles is 4,889 SDR per person, measured in 2024.
That represents a change of up 15.1% on the previous year and up 39.1% over ten years.
Over the whole period, total reserves (gold at market value) (sdr), per capita in Seychelles peaked at 5,057 SDR per person in 2021 and was at its lowest, 62.22 SDR per person, in 1973.
Seychelles ranks 27th of 179 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ated
Total reserves (gold at market value) (SDR) div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Total reserves (gold at market value) (SDR) ÷ Population, total
Computed from
- Total reserves (gold at market value) International Monetary Fund
- Population, total World Population Prospects, United Nations (UN)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
